Massimo Greco is a scholar working on Civil and Structural Engineering, Ecology and Computational Mechanics. According to data from OpenAlex, Massimo Greco has authored 32 papers receiving a total of 626 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Civil and Structural Engineering, 11 papers in Ecology and 8 papers in Computational Mechanics. Recurrent topics in Massimo Greco's work include Hydrology and Sediment Transport Processes (11 papers), Hydrology and Watershed Management Studies (6 papers) and Flood Risk Assessment and Management (6 papers). Massimo Greco is often cited by papers focused on Hydrology and Sediment Transport Processes (11 papers), Hydrology and Watershed Management Studies (6 papers) and Flood Risk Assessment and Management (6 papers). Massimo Greco collaborates with scholars based in Italy, Switzerland and Latvia. Massimo Greco's co-authors include Michele Iervolino, Andrea Vacca, Angelo Leopardi, Bruno Brunone, Giuseppe Del Giudice, Cristiana Di Cristo, Stefania Evangelista, Lukas Schmocker, Willi H. Hager and Donatella Termini and has published in prestigious journals such as SHILAP Revista de lepidopterología, Advances in Water Resources and Journal of Hydraulic Engineering.
